Telecom Namibia and Angola Telecom cooperate on subsea connectivity

Telecom Namibia and Angola Telecom announced on Thursday they have signed an MoU and commercial terms agreement (CTA) to boost regional and international subsea cable connectivity along Southern Africa’s west coast.

The MOU and CTA establish a commercially sustainable framework to govern cooperation between the two telcos, including long‑term access to international capacity, shared operational principles, and a milestone‑based commercial structure.

More specifically, Angola Telecom will gain access to international capacity via Telecom Namibia’s Equiano subsea cable landing in Swakopmund under the deal. Meanwhile, the agreements also lay the groundwork for deeper collaboration linked to Angola Telecom’s planned Southern Africa Regional Submarine Cable System (SARSSy).

The SARSSy cable project aims to interconnect with Equiano via the Swakopmund  landing station, and provide additional international capacity to Namibia, Angola and other countries along the west coast of Southern Africa, while also enhancing Angola’s infrastructure sovereignty, redundancy, and international reach, said Angola Telecom CEO Adilson Miguel dos Santos.

“This collaboration with Telecom Namibia enables us to extend the reach and resilience of Angola’s international connectivity,” he said in a statement. “By integrating SARSSy with Equiano through Swakopmund, we are strengthening Angola’s position within the regional digital ecosystem and ensuring scalable, reliable capacity for the future.”

Telecom Namibia CEO Dr. Stanley Shanapinda added, “By leveraging the Equiano Subsea Cable and working in partnership with Angola Telecom, we are strengthening network resilience, expanding international bandwidth, and positioning Namibia as a key digital transit hub for the region.”

Deutsche Telekom reportedly considers merger with T-Mobile US

Deutsche Telekom is reportedly considering a merger with T-Mobile US, a move that could create the largest telecom in the world.

A report by Bloomberg says Deutsche Telekom is considering a merger with T-Mobile US.

The report cites people familiar with the deal as confirming that early-stage talks have begun regarding the creation of a holding company that would make bids for shares from both publicly traded companies.

Currently, Deutsche Telekom holds a majority stake (53%) in T-Mobile US.

Their involvement with T-Mobile US stretches back decades.

Bloomberg also reports that successful discussions may be contingent on commitments to maintain operations in Germany.

According to Bloomberg, the theoretical deal, if it gained regulatory approval, would set a record for the largest public M&A and simultaneously create the world’s largest telecom.

Yahoo! has reported that the deal could create a telecom with a market value approaching $300 billion, though they also point out that Berlin will hold influence over any future decisions.

Currently, Deutsche Telekom is 28% held by state lender KfW and the German government, Yahoo! reported.

Both companies have declined opportunities to comment on the reports.

Bangladeshi telcos warn of shutdowns due to fuel crisis

The country is one of the worst impacted by the ongoing war in Iran, with the majority of its fuel typically being imported from the Middle East

This week, Bangladesh’s telecoms network operators are warning that they may soon be forced to shut down services due to a lack of fuel.

In a letter to the Bangladesh Telecommunication Regulatory Commission (BTRC), the Association of Mobile Telecom Operators of Bangladesh (AMTOB) said that the industry is facing “severe operational distress due to the prolonged unavailability of commercial power and the lack of assured fuel supply for backup systems”.

“The situation has escalated beyond the operational control,” said the AMTOB in the letter. “If these conditions persist, there is an imminent risk of large-scale telecom network shutdowns across significant parts of the country.”

Bangladesh is facing a sever fuel shortage caused by the ongoing war in Iran, which has limited the export of vital fuel supplies from the Middle East. Around 80% of Bangladesh’s crude oil and 65% of its natural gas are imported from the region.

Fuel prices in Bangladesh have risen by around 15% since the start of the conflict and rationing is being imposed by the government.

For the telcos, which operate much of their infrastructure using this fuel, the situation could soon be untenable. Base transceiver stations (BTS) consume over 52,000 litres of diesel and 20,000 litres of octane daily, while data centre operations use around 500–600 litres of diesel per hour, or around 4,000 litres per day per facility.

“Multiple strategically vital telecom facilities are currently running on dangerously low fuel reserves,” said the letter.

Network operators are calling on the government to grant parts of their networks priority in order to ensure that critical services like mobile financial transactions and emergency response can remain operational.

Veon’s Banglalink to offer Starlink Mobile D2C service in Bangladesh

Veon Group announced on Wednesday that its Bangladesh subsidiary Banglalink has signed an agreement with Starlink Mobile to integrate its Direct to Cell (D2C) satellite connectivity in remote areas with Banglalink’s terrestrial coverage.

Banglalink will launch Starlink’s D2C service later this year, giving its customers access to Starlink Mobile satellites using standard 4G smartphones, although the service will initially be limited to text messaging.

Banglalink said it will introduce data services in the next phase of Starlink Mobile’s rollout, pending regulatory approvals.

“By enhancing our connectivity with Starlink’s satellite-to-mobile technology, we aim to ensure that Banglalink customers will not be limited by the availability of terrestrial networks,” said Banglalink CEO Johan Buse in a statement.

Banglalink’s Starlink Mobile tie-up is the third such deal for Veon’s operator stable, following the commercial launch of D2C service with Ukraine’s Kyivstar in November 2025 and a field test with Beeline Kazakhstan in December 2025 that also marked the first WhatsApp call over Starlink’s network in Central Asia. Beeline Kazakhstan aims to launch commercial D2C services later this year.

“By expanding our partnership with Starlink into Bangladesh, we are redefining resilience and opening up new possibilities for our digital ecosystem – now in the third country across the five markets that we proudly serve,” said Veon Group CEO Kaan Terzioglu.

NTT Data launches 400 Gbps peering in South Africa’s JINX

NTT Data announced on Monday that it has established active 400 Gbps peering at the Johannesburg Internet Exchange (JINX), adding that it’s the first network operator in Africa to do so.

NTT Data said its 400 Gbps peering capability signals that South Africa’s internet exchange environment is operating at a level comparable to leading global markets, supporting growing demand for high-capacity, low-latency connectivity.

For local businesses, the upgrade delivers tangible benefits, including improved performance during peak demand periods, greater capacity to support sustained traffic growth and enhanced reliability across digital services, said said JC Burger, director of infrastructure engineering and operations at NTT DATA in South Africa.

“Africa’s Internet traffic is growing rapidly and the demand for scalable, resilient and low-latency connectivity continues to increase,” Burger said in a statement. “Establishing 400Gbps peering at JINX is a strategic investment that strengthens our ability to deliver high-performance connectivity while supporting the long-term growth of Africa’s digital economy.”

JINX – which was established in 1996 as Africa’s first Internet exchange point – is operated by the Internet Exchange Point of South Africa (INX‑ZA), a division of the Internet Service Providers’ Association (ISPA).

Arelion upgrades Nørre Nebel site, prepares for more subsea cables

These developments support the continued growth of the Nordic digital infrastructure market amid significant private data center expansion in Jutland and Copenhagen

Arelion is upgrading its Nørre Nebel site to support additional cable landings and long-term network scalability. The site is fully operational and project-ready with front haul, back haul and subsea horizontal directional drilling (HDDs) for landing multiple diverse sea cables in place.

The global internet carrier is leveraging its network of ducts on the north route from Nørre Nebel to Copenhagen via a unique subsea cable system from Aarhus to Copenhagen. On the south route, ducts passing Esbjerg to Kolding and Copenhagen add resilience and route diversity, with Kolding serving as a key junction point for routes south to Germany and east to Copenhagen.

These investments are part of Arelion’s ongoing strategy to connect many new data center developments in the region to its network, including the recently completed new duct and cable extensions connecting the atNorth DEN01 Copenhagen data center to Arelion’s Nordic AI superhighway.

Complementing the infrastructure, new optical systems supporting wavelength capacity have been added between Amsterdam and Kolding to enable more efficient traffic routing and offer diversity bypass options for Hamburg.

The improvements strengthen connectivity for customers in Denmark’s expanding data center markets and align with broader European initiatives to improve subsea and terrestrial infrastructure across the North Sea region. Denmark’s access to renewable energy and its strategic position continue to support its emergence as a regional data center hub, with the national market expected to reach $2.9 billion by 2030 at a compound annual growth rate (CAGR) of 11.44 percent.

“These upgrades to our Danish network reflect our broader commitment to strengthening digital infrastructure across the Nordics, helping us support enterprise and wholesale customers with low-latency, fully diverse connectivity and predictable performance as they deploy AI applications,” said Johan Ottosson, VP Strategy & Product Management at Arelion. “Our continued investment ensures the capacity needed to keep pace with accelerating demand for AI-driven services, providing a scalable and secure foundation for both training workloads and latency-sensitive inference use cases.”

AST SpaceMobile satellite placed into wrong orbit

The failed deployment could hinder commercial pilots of direct-to-device (D2D) services for AST’s mobile operator partners

Satellite company AST SpaceMobile has hit a setback this week, with its latest BlueBird 7 satellite being deployed in the wrong orbit.

The launch, which took pace on Sunday, saw BlueBird 7 carried into low Earth Orbit (LEO) by Blue Origin’s New Glenn reusable rocket. However, issues in deployment led to the satellite being placed into too low an orbit.

“During the New Glenn 3 mission, BlueBird 7 was placed into a lower than planned orbit by the upper stage of the launch vehicle. While the satellite separated from the launch vehicle and powered on, the altitude is too low to sustain operations with its on-board thruster technology and will [be] de-orbited,” explained AST SpaceMobile in a statement, noting that the cost of the lost satellite was covered by an insurance policy.

AST is currently in the process of deploying a constellation of roughly 90 LEO satellites, which will be used to provide global coverage of D2D satellite services. This will allow AST’s mobile operator partners, such as Vodafone and AT&T, to provide customers with coverage beyond the limits of their terrestrial networks.

AST currently has six active satellites in orbit, which provide intermittent coverage and have primarily been used for preliminary tests of the company’s D2D technology. BlueBird 7 was set to be the first of the company’s upgraded satellites, with 45–60 additional devices targeted for launch before the end of the year.

“The company is currently in production through BlueBird 32, with BlueBird 8 to 10 expected to be ready to ship in approximately 30 days,” said the company statement. “The company continues to expect an orbital launch every one to two months on average during 2026, supported by agreements with multiple launch providers, and it continues to target approximately 45 satellites in orbit by the end of 2026.”

The extent to which the failure to deliver BlueBird7 will impact AST’s customers is unclear. VodafoneThree, for example, is scheduled to begin trials of the technology with customers this summer.
